Ex-UA star Rob Gronkowski graces 'Madden' cover

Rob Gronkowski just became the first New England Patriots player and first tight end to appear on the cover of one of the highest grossing video-game series of all-time.

He's the first Arizona Wildcat to appear on the cover, too.

Gronkowski, a four-time All-Pro and Pro Bowler, will appear on the cover of Madden NFL 17. The announcement was made official on ESPN's SportsCenter on Thursday afternoon.

The 26-year-old Gronkowski played for the Wildcats from 2007-09. He set UA single-game, season and career records for a tight end in total receptions, receiving yards and touchdowns.

Gronkowski sat out his junior season with a back injury and then decided to declare for the NFL Draft after the season. He became a world champion in 2015 when he helped guide the Patriots to the Super Bowl XLIX championship in Glendale.

It's been quite a day for Gronk, as he appeared on the cover of GQ magazine earlier on Thursday.
